document.getElementById('mydownload').onclick= function(){ var wrapper = document.getElementById('wrapper'); //dom to image domtoimage.toSvg(wrapper).then(function (svgDataUrl) { //download function downloadPNGFromAnyImageSrc(svgDataUrl); }); } function downloadPNGFromAnyImageSrc(src) { ...
raw直接拿到 SVG 文本内容,给你动态转成 Base64。 代码语言:javascript 复制 importiconSvgfrom'./image/someIcon.svg?raw';// 这个会拿到 "<svg ...>...</svg>"consttoSVGDataUrl=(str:string)=>{constbase64=btoa(str);return`data:image/svg+xml;base64,${base64}`;};<img:src="toSVGDataUrl(...
raw直接拿到 SVG 文本内容,给你动态转成 Base64。 import iconSvg from './image/someIcon.svg?raw'; // 这个会拿到 "<svg ...>...</svg>" const toSVGDataUrl = (str: string) => { const base64 = btoa(str); return `data:image/svg+xml;base64,${base64}`; }; <img :src="toSVGDa...
This display correctly when the page load (ie. it is using the symbol that I refer to using use tag). I want to take this SVG and get the base64 dataurl (convert it to an image). I tried to use this code without success, it always gets me a white/blank image. function convertS...
在CSS样式中,使用background-image属性来设置背景图像,并将Base64编码的字符串作为属性值。例如: 代码语言:txt 复制 .element { background-image: url(data:image/svg+xml;base64,Base64编码的SVG图像); } 根据需要,可以使用其他CSS属性来调整背景图像的显示方式,例如background-size、background-position等。 ...
1.data:mime/type;base64,[actual data]:base64 编码,更适合于二进制数据(PNG,fonts,SVGZ 等等) 2.data:mime/type;charset=[charset],[actual data]:URL 编码的普通文本,更适合与文本标记语言(SVG,HTML等) 所以,把一个 SVG 文件编码为 data URL 的正确方式为data:image/svg+xml;charset=utf8,[actual da...
let pngBase64Fun = this.svgBase64ToPngBase64(svgBase64); pngBase64Fun.then((res) => { // 将svg base64转 pngbase64后执行回调函数,res 为转换后的png base64 this.$emit('callBack', res);//res数据 格式:data:image/png;base64,... }) }...
ToolFk还支持BarCode条形码在线生成、QueryList采集器、PHP代码在线运行、PHP混淆、加密、解密、Python代码在线运行、JavaScript在线运行、YAML格式化工具、HTTP模拟查询工具、HTML在线工具箱、JavaScript在线工具箱、CSS在线工具箱、JSON在线工具箱、Unixtime时间戳转换、Base64/URL/Native2Ascii转换、CSV转换工具箱、XML在线工具...
// create a new image to hold it the converted type var img = new Image; // when the image is loaded we can get it as base64 url img.onload = function() { // draw it to the canvas ctx.drawImage(this, margin, margin);
This text is displayed if your browser does not support the Canvas HTML element. Make SVG This sample shows how to setup anelementFinishedoption forDiagram.makeSvgthat will replace the SVG<image>tag'shrefwith a Base64 URI instead of pointing to thePicture.source. This can be useful to reduc...